Importing a Harness into Capital Systems Integrator
You can use Capital Systems Integrator to import the data for an individual harness from an XML file that you have exported from Capital. When importing the harness data, you can either create a new harness in the design or overwrite an existing harness.
Prerequisites
- You must have a set of Capital Logic Designer designs that cover everything in the harness and those designs must be associated with the Capital Systems Integrator design into which you are importing the harness.
Procedure
- With a Capital Systems Integrator diagram open, either:Press Space Bar and enter Import Harness.
Right-click the harness to be overwritten in the Design Browser (Design tab) and choose Import Harness.
An Import Harness dialog box displays
- Browse to the XML file, select it and click Import.
Results
If you selected a harness to overwrite, the new harness data is imported and overwrites it.
If you did not select a harness to overwrite, the new harness is imported and is added to the Design Browser (Design tab) and is placed in free space in the diagram window. Note that if it has the same name as an existing harness in the design, a message displays on a Harness Import tab in the Output Window at the bottom of the application.
If you have overwritten a harness, the Harness Import tab in the Output Window also reports on any changes that are required to any other harnesses as a result of the import and displays any warnings where differing data has caused issues.
If you are importing a harness that was created across multiple diagrams, the system returns the objects to each diagram if they exist or creates the diagrams as required.
Although the data file does not include actual library parts, it does include object attributes such as Part Number so the import automatically re-associates any available library parts.
Slots on the imported harness that also exist on other harnesses are merged.
Constraints on the imported harness and its child objects are retained.
Rules that are on the imported harness and its children and are present (matched by UID and then name) on the harness to be overwritten are retained on the harness after the import.
Rules that are on the harness in the XML file but are not in the database are removed and do not appear on the harness after the import.
References to custom constraints are included in the transfer but the constraints themselves are not.
Harness levels on the imported harness are retained.
Vehicle models are not included in the transfer.
If an option (matched by UID and then name) does not exist on the target project. In this case, the import removes the option from any harness levels that reference it.
You can map a combined wire to an inline cavity. During export, all inlines convert to interface connectors. When an interface connector imports onto a target diagram, the signal carried by that wire is a combined signal. When an importing harness contains a combined signal that is not present on the diagram, the import combines the appropriate matching child signals on the design to create a new combined signal if the user has the diagram locked.
If an imported slot contains a device that is currently placed in a different slot on the target design, the device is unplaced from the slot on the target design and the wiring is deleted. The exception to this is when the device is variantly placed in both slots and the variants are different, in which case the device is left alone.
If a slot in the XML file already exists on the diagram but exists on multiple harnesses, the incoming slot merges with the target slot following these rules: All slot connectors on the incoming harness are added to the existing slot.
If the devices in a slot are not mapped to the connectors that are being imported, then they are left alone.
Properties of the incoming slot are merged into the existing slot. If there is a collision between properties, the incoming slot is the master.
Rules on the incoming slot are added to the existing slot - collisions are not resolved.
- Connectors are imported following the same rules as described for slots.
